卢旺达胡耶综合市场和兰戈当地市场所售水果的寄生虫学研究

Parasitological Study on Fruits Sold in Huye Complex Market and Rango Local Market in Rwanda.

作者信息

Murinda Eric, Dusabimana Ally

机构信息

Department of Biomedical Laboratory Sciences (BLS), Faculty of of science and Technology Catholic University of Rwanda.

出版信息

East Afr Health Res J. 2024;8(1):106-110. doi: 10.24248/eahrj.v8i1.755. Epub 2024 Mar 28.

DOI:10.24248/eahrj.v8i1.755
PMID:39234346
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C11371017/
Abstract

BACKGROUND

Fruits are essential for good health and they form a major component of human diet. They are vital energy contributors that are depended upon all levels of human as food supplement or nutrients. Although they have all these benefits, when there are not handled with good hygiene they can transmit parasitic infections especially intestinal parasitic infections in the world including Rwanda. The study was conducted to determine the parasitological patterns on fruits purchased in "Huye complex market and Rango local market" in southern province of Rwanda.

OBJECTIVE

To assess and identify the parasitological patterns on fruits purchased in Huye complex market and Rango local market in Southern Province of Rwanda.

METHODOLOGY

A cross-sectional study was designed and 188 fruits were sampled from Huye complex market and Rango local market then washed by using normal saline and the suspension was centrifuged and the sedimentation was examined on a microscope. Data was analysed using Statistical Package for Social Sciences (SPSS) version 23.0 and MS Excel.

RESULTS

The overall prevalence of all parasites obtained from the fruits was 52.65%, whereby the prevalence of all parasites in Rango local and Huye complex markets was 66.63% and 44.7%, respectively. The frequency of identified parasites' contamination was 44.44%, cysts of 24.24%, eggs of 10.1%, cysts of 17.17% and 4.04%.

CONCLUSION

The level of fruits contamination by pathogenic parasites remain high, hence regular health education on hygiene of fruit have to be increased to the population and continuous monitoring on sellers of fruits is required.

摘要

背景

水果对健康至关重要,是人类饮食的主要组成部分。它们是重要的能量来源,在人类的各个层面都被用作食物补充剂或营养物质。尽管水果有这些益处,但如果处理时卫生条件不佳,它们可能传播寄生虫感染,尤其是在包括卢旺达在内的世界各地传播肠道寄生虫感染。本研究旨在确定在卢旺达南部省份“胡耶综合市场和兰戈当地市场”购买的水果上的寄生虫学模式。

目的

评估并识别在卢旺达南部省份胡耶综合市场和兰戈当地市场购买的水果上的寄生虫学模式。

方法

设计了一项横断面研究,从胡耶综合市场和兰戈当地市场采集了188份水果样本,然后用生理盐水清洗,将悬浮液离心,在显微镜下检查沉淀物。使用社会科学统计软件包(SPSS)23.0版和MS Excel对数据进行分析。

结果

从水果中检出的所有寄生虫的总体感染率为52.65%,其中兰戈当地市场和胡耶综合市场所有寄生虫的感染率分别为66.63%和44.7%。已识别的寄生虫污染频率为44.44%,包囊为24.24%,虫卵为10.1%,包囊为17.17%,其他为4.04%。

结论

致病寄生虫对水果的污染水平仍然很高,因此必须加强对民众进行关于水果卫生的定期健康教育,并对水果销售商进行持续监测。
